收藏
回答

scroll-view onshow时也触发scroll-top

问题模块 框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
API和组件 小程序 Bug scroll-view 微信安卓客户端 7.0.4 2.7.7

scroll-view onshow时也触发scroll-top,回到了顶部

最后一次编辑于  07-30  (未经腾讯允许,不得转载)
回答关注问题邀请回答
收藏

3 个回答

  • 社区技术运营专员-白柿子
    社区技术运营专员-白柿子
    07-30

    麻烦提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html

    07-30
    赞同
    回复 1
    • 何以为歌
      何以为歌
      09-04
      我也遇到了这个问题,主要 scrollview 绑定了scroll-top onshow的时候就会回到顶部,实际onshow根本没写代码,连onshow方法都没写
      09-04
      回复
  • 吴奕群
    吴奕群
    07-31

    你的onshow代码是怎么写的

    07-31
    赞同
    回复 6
    • ᴴᴱᴸᴸᴼ
      ᴴᴱᴸᴸᴼ
      07-31
      onshow里没代码,手机亮屏会触发,跳到其它页面,返回来,也会触发,也不算是onshow的时候吧,不过页面显示时,就会走 :scroll-top="scrollTop"跳到顶部了
      07-31
      回复
    • 吴奕群
      吴奕群
      07-31回复ᴴᴱᴸᴸᴼ
      app.js呢?
      07-31
      回复
    • ᴴᴱᴸᴸᴼ
      ᴴᴱᴸᴸᴼ
      07-31回复吴奕群
      那里都是没问题的,
      07-31
      回复
    • 吴奕群
      吴奕群
      07-31回复ᴴᴱᴸᴸᴼ
      可以的话,提供一个可以复现的代码片段,这样好排查
      07-31
      回复
    • ᴴᴱᴸᴸᴼ
      ᴴᴱᴸᴸᴼ
      08-01回复吴奕群
      A页面是scrollview,设置是scroll-top属性,这样测下就好啦,mpvue的小程序不知道怎么提供代码片段过来~~
      08-01
      回复
    查看更多(1)
  • ᴴᴱᴸᴸᴼ
    ᴴᴱᴸᴸᴼ
    07-30

    <scroll-view class="content-scroll-view" :scroll-top="scrollTop" @scrolltolower="lower" scroll-y>

    data里这个scrollTop=0,可以测下跳转页面后返回,也一样会回到顶部

    07-30
    赞同
    回复